About Urea Moisturizer

Urea based moisturizers are gaining attention as effective, dermatologist recommended options for dry, irritated, or sensitive skin due to urea's humectant and kerolytic properties.

Trend Decomposition

Trend Decomposition

Trigger: Increased consumer focus on barrier repair and clinical skincare ingredients leading to renewed interest in urea based formulations.

Behavior change: Consumers are selecting higher urea concentration moisturizers and applying them more regularly, including for conditions like eczema and xerosis.

Enabler: Wider availability of OTC urea products and clearer labeling of active concentration and skin benefits.

Constraint removed: Reduced reliance on fragrance free, medicated prescriptions by empowering consumers with effective, accessible OTC options.

Jobs to be done framework

Jobs to be done framework

What problem does this trend help solve?

Dry, irritated, or compromised skin requiring intensive moisturization and barrier support.

What workaround existed before?

Use of bland creams or prescription products with less favorable texture or accessibility; trial and error with various moisturizers.

What outcome matters most?

Efficacy and speed of relief, tolerability for sensitive skin, and overall value in a daily routine.
